Definition of Dispersion in Optics Dispersion is a fundamental optical phenomenon where white light separates into its individual spectral colors upon passing through a medium. This occurs because different wavelengths of light refract, or bend, by varying amounts depending on the material they traverse. Definition of Chiral Liquids Chiral liquids are a unique category of fluids distinguished by the asymmetry of their molecular structures. The term “chirality” derives from the Greek word “cheir,” meaning hand, symbolizing the property where molecules exist as non-superimposable mirror images, much like left and right hands. Definition of Fiber Optics Technology Fiber optics technology refers to the transmission of information as pulses of light through strands of glass or plastic fibers. This method leverages the properties of light to carry data over long distances with minimal loss, enabling high-speed communication and a variety of applications across multiple industries.
